Softball Recap: Union Grove Christian Patriots vs. Greater Vision Academy Lions

Union Grove Christian had already won three in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 3.7 runs), and they went ahead and made it four on Tuesday. They walked away with a 7-2 victory over the Greater Vision Academy Lions. That result was just more of the same for these two, as Union Grove Christian also won the last time the pair played on Tuesday.

Morgan Donovant made a splash no matter where she played. She looked comfortable on the mound, striking out eight batters over five innings while giving up just one earned (and one unearned) run off four hits (and only one walk). Donovant has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't given up more than two walks in four consecutive pitching appearances. Donovant was also big at the plate, scoring two runs while going 2-for-4.

In other batting news, Union Grove Christian got a big performance out of Reagan Lambert, who scored two runs while getting on base in all three of her plate appearances. Another player making a difference was Hannah Tapler, who went 2-for-3 with two RBI.

Union Grove Christian has been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six contests, which provided a massive bump to their 6-9 record this season. As for Greater Vision Academy, they are on a five-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 3-6.
